Jordan
Status under International Climate Change Law
- UNFCCC: signature (11 June 1992) and ratification (12 Nov 1993)
- KP: ratification (17 Jan 2003)
Quantified emission limitation or reduction commitment: NA - Vienna Convention: accession (31 May 1989)
- Montreal Protocol: accession (31 May 1989)
- LRTAP: NA
- Energy Charter: observer, signature (07 Dec 2007)
- Energy Efficiency Protocol: accession pending
- Espoo Convention: NA

Energy
- General Electricity Law No. 64 (2003) β general regulatory framework for the generation, distribution, and sale of electricity in Jordan. Makes energy efficiency a national priority
- Master Strategy of the Energy Sector (2007) [English]
- Renewable Energy & Energy Efficiency Law No. 3 (2010) [English] β provides the legislative framework to encourage exploitation of renewable energy sources, further supply-side energy efficiency, and streamline private sector investment through incentives.
